Add (1.3t3 + 0.4t2 – 24t) + (8 – 18t + 0.6t2) For each term in the second polynomial, enter the letter showing where that term s
nignag [31]

Answer:

(1.3t^3 + 0.4t^2 - 24t) + (8 - 18t + 0.6t^2) = 1.3t^3 + t^2 -42t  + 8

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

(1.3t^3 + 0.4t^2 - 24t) + (8 - 18t + 0.6t^2)

Required

Solve

We have:

(1.3t^3 + 0.4t^2 - 24t) + (8 - 18t + 0.6t^2)

Collect like terms

1.3t^3 + 0.6t^2 + 0.4t^2 - 24t- 18t  + 8

1.3t^3 + t^2 -42t  + 8

So:

(1.3t^3 + 0.4t^2 - 24t) + (8 - 18t + 0.6t^2) = 1.3t^3 + t^2 -42t  + 8
